Classic buggy with a modern build

The Tamiya Grasshopper II 58643-60A revives a late 1980s favourite and adapts it for current hobby use. This 1/10 scale 2WD kit keeps the original styling but adds compatibility with common aftermarket parts, making it a good project for tuners and collectors alike.

Build and materials

This model sits on an ABS resin bathtub chassis that provides a sturdy base for off-road running. The polystyrene body is supplied in white and includes a driver figure for scale effect. The combination of a front swing axle and rear rolling rigid suspension, supported by coil-sprung friction dampers, delivers predictable behaviour across rough sections.

Traction and power options

Features include ribbed front tyres and pin-spike rear tyres mounted on 8-spoke wheels for reliable traction. The enclosed rear gearbox contains a differential to aid cornering and stability. The kit does not ship with an ESC but is compatible with controllers like Tamiya's TBLE-02 S for both brushed and brushless motors.

Specifications

  • Scale: 1/10
  • Drive Type: 2WD
  • Chassis: ABS Resin Bathtub
  • Suspension: Independent Front/Solid Axle Rear
  • Shock Damper: Friction Damper
  • Tire Type: Rubber with Grooved Front/Pin Spike Rear
  • Motor: 380-brushed type
  • Electronic Speed Control (ESC): Not Included
